Swiss VAT: rates, threshold and filings

Three rates coexist in Switzerland: 8.1% for most supplies, 2.6% for everyday essentials and 3.8% for accommodation. Businesses staying under CHF 100,000 a year are exempt from registration but may opt in voluntarily — useful to reclaim input VAT on investments.

For an SME in Uster, electronic filing of VAT returns has been mandatory since 1 January 2025; the tax administration's online portal is also where extensions are requested and past periods consulted. Frequently asked questions

When is entry in the commercial register mandatory?

A Sàrl and an SA only come into existence with their registration. A sole proprietorship must register from CHF 100,000 of annual revenue; below that, registration stays voluntary but adds credibility and protects the business name. Registration goes through the canton's commercial register office — for Uster too.

When must a business register for VAT?

As soon as its worldwide annual turnover reaches CHF 100,000 (CHF 250,000 for non-profit sports or cultural associations). Below that, voluntary registration remains possible and often makes sense to reclaim input VAT on investments. The threshold is federal: it applies in Uster as everywhere in Switzerland.

Which social contributions does a Swiss employer pay?

AHV/IV/APG: 5.3% employer share (the same is withheld from the employee); unemployment insurance: 1.1% each up to CHF 148,200 a year; occupational pension (LPP) by age and plan (employer at least 50%); occupational accident insurance paid by the employer; family allowances by canton. For an employer in Uster, family allowances follow the canton's rates.
